| Well I do know of some people who own grinders and grind the bones and meat up so it would look like a premade, but thats only because they have dogs who have are elderly and have missing teeth or for weaning puppies etc. I give consumable raw meaty bones, which they crunch up and eat so thats where they get their bone from. Then I also of course give raw muscle meat, organ meat, green tripe and occasionally other bits too. |
